🔑 Enhanced Key Takeaways
- •NVIDIA's AI-RAN alliance partners include T-Mobile, Nokia, Cisco, MITRE, ODC, and Booz Allen Hamilton, with T-Mobile building an AI-RAN Innovation Center and Nokia implementing the Aerial RAN Computer Pro for 6G-ready systems.[1][3]
- •AI-RAN architecture boosts bandwidth utilization from 50-60% to over 97% using NVIDIA Spectrum-X, yielding significant energy savings and enabling edge AI revenue streams amid 90% of operators reporting AI-driven revenue growth.[1]
- •SynaXG demonstrated a benchmark with 36 Gbps throughput and under 10ms latency on a single NVIDIA GH200 server running 4G/5G bands and AI workloads, marking the first AI-RAN on FR2 mmWave bands.[5]
- •NVIDIA launched the AI-WIN project in October with U.S. partners for an all-American AI-RAN stack, and collaborates with a Korean consortium on secure programmable 6G networks.[3][6]
🛠️ Technical Deep Dive
- •NVIDIA AI Aerial uses GPU acceleration and AI algorithms for software-defined RAN, supporting Open-RAN, Centralized-RAN, Distributed-RAN, and Cloud-RAN variants from 5G vRAN to AI-native 6G.[2]
- •Enables 6G R&D across RAN stack layers with AI/ML algorithms for L1/L2, using open-source libraries, synthetic/real-world datasets for training from link-level to city-scale simulations.[2]
- •Nokia's anyRAN software tested on NVIDIA GPU-accelerated platform with T-Mobile, Indosat, SoftBank, validating scalability for AI-powered RAN deployments.[7]
- •AI Aerial allows continuous software upgrades for 6G without hardware changes, providing a homogenous architecture for public/private networks.[2]
